About 107 Church Hill
107 Church Hill is an end-of-terrace house in Waltham Forest, London, London (E17 3BD).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 818 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(October 2018)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in July 2014 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). At 76 m² this is the 18th smallest of 35 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 16–184 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to C across 35 units on file.
Across 1996–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 9.7%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£795/sq ft) was about 259.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£650,000 in September 2023.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2026.
